NOW Demands Equal Pay for Mothers

WASHINGTON, D.C.— Today, NOW recognizes Mom’s Equal Pay Day and acknowledges the enormous wage disparities between mothers and fathers in our nation. Ahmaud Arbery’s Murder Was Also A Hate Crime
